| /linux-6.15/drivers/staging/gpib/tnt4882/ |
| H A D | mite.c | 60 mite = kzalloc(sizeof(*mite), GFP_KERNEL); in mite_init() 61 if (!mite) in mite_init() 86 mite->mite_io_addr = ioremap(addr, pci_resource_len(mite->pcidev, 0)); in mite_setup() 93 mite->daq_io_addr = ioremap(mite->daq_phys_addr, pci_resource_len(mite->pcidev, 1)); in mite_setup() 99 mite->used = 1; in mite_setup() 107 for (mite = mite_devices; mite; mite = next) { in mite_cleanup() 108 next = mite->next; in mite_cleanup() 109 if (mite->pcidev) in mite_cleanup() 111 kfree(mite); in mite_cleanup() 117 if (!mite) in mite_unsetup() [all …]
|
| H A D | mite.h | 48 extern inline unsigned int mite_irq(struct mite_struct *mite) in mite_irq() argument 50 return mite->pcidev->irq; in mite_irq() 53 extern inline unsigned int mite_device_id(struct mite_struct *mite) in mite_device_id() argument 55 return mite->pcidev->device; in mite_device_id() 60 int mite_setup(struct mite_struct *mite); 61 void mite_unsetup(struct mite_struct *mite);
|
| H A D | tnt4882_gpib.c | 46 struct mite_struct *mite; member 907 struct mite_struct *mite; in ni_pci_attach() local 923 for (mite = mite_devices; mite; mite = mite->next) { in ni_pci_attach() 926 if (mite->used) in ni_pci_attach() 932 switch (mite_device_id(mite)) { in ni_pci_attach() 952 if (!mite) in ni_pci_attach() 955 tnt_priv->mite = mite; in ni_pci_attach() 956 retval = mite_setup(tnt_priv->mite); in ni_pci_attach() 969 tnt_priv->irq = mite_irq(tnt_priv->mite); in ni_pci_attach() 997 if (tnt_priv->mite) in ni_pci_detach() [all …]
|
| H A D | Makefile | 3 tnt4882-objs := tnt4882_gpib.o mite.o
|
| /linux-6.15/drivers/comedi/drivers/ |
| H A D | mite.c | 217 struct mite *mite = mite_chan->mite; in mite_device_bytes_transferred() local 228 struct mite *mite = mite_chan->mite; in mite_bytes_in_transit() local 362 struct mite *mite = mite_chan->mite; in mite_get_status() local 389 struct mite *mite = mite_chan->mite; in mite_ack_linkc() local 416 struct mite *mite = mite_chan->mite; in mite_done() local 440 struct mite *mite = mite_chan->mite; in mite_dma_arm() local 462 struct mite *mite = mite_chan->mite; in mite_dma_disarm() local 478 struct mite *mite = mite_chan->mite; in mite_prep_dma() local 613 struct mite *mite = mite_chan->mite; in mite_release_channel() local 878 struct mite *mite; in mite_attach() local [all …]
|
| H A D | mite.h | 37 struct mite *mite; member 44 struct mite { struct 67 struct mite_channel *mite_request_channel_in_range(struct mite *mite, argument 71 struct mite_channel *mite_request_channel(struct mite *mite, 79 struct mite_ring *mite_alloc_ring(struct mite *mite); 82 struct mite *mite_attach(struct comedi_device *dev, bool use_win1); 83 void mite_detach(struct mite *mite);
|
| H A D | ni_pcimio.c | 1222 struct mite *mite = devpriv->mite; in m_series_init_eeprom_buffer() local 1232 daq_phys_addr = pci_resource_start(mite->pcidev, 1); in m_series_init_eeprom_buffer() 1234 old_iodwbsr_bits = readl(mite->mmio + MITE_IODWBSR); in m_series_init_eeprom_buffer() 1236 old_iodwcr1_bits = readl(mite->mmio + MITE_IODWCR_1); in m_series_init_eeprom_buffer() 1237 writel(0x0, mite->mmio + MITE_IODWBSR); in m_series_init_eeprom_buffer() 1239 mite->mmio + MITE_IODWBSR_1); in m_series_init_eeprom_buffer() 1241 writel(0xf, mite->mmio + 0x30); in m_series_init_eeprom_buffer() 1247 writel(old_iodwbsr_bits, mite->mmio + MITE_IODWBSR); in m_series_init_eeprom_buffer() 1249 writel(0x0, mite->mmio + 0x30); in m_series_init_eeprom_buffer() 1292 mite_detach(devpriv->mite); in pcimio_detach() [all …]
|
| H A D | ni_pcidio.c | 284 struct mite *mite; member 301 mite_request_channel_in_range(devpriv->mite, in ni_pcidio_request_di_mite_channel() 858 ret = comedi_load_firmware(dev, &devpriv->mite->pcidev->dev, in pci_6534_upload_firmware() 906 devpriv->mite = mite_attach(dev, false); /* use win0 */ in nidio_auto_attach() 907 if (!devpriv->mite) in nidio_auto_attach() 910 devpriv->di_mite_ring = mite_alloc_ring(devpriv->mite); in nidio_auto_attach() 971 mite_detach(devpriv->mite); in nidio_detach()
|
| H A D | ni_660x.c | 257 struct mite *mite; member 347 mite_chan = mite_request_channel(devpriv->mite, ring); in ni_660x_request_mite_channel() 509 devpriv->ring[i][j] = mite_alloc_ring(devpriv->mite); in ni_660x_alloc_mite_rings() 1026 devpriv->mite = mite_attach(dev, true); /* use win1 */ in ni_660x_auto_attach() 1027 if (!devpriv->mite) in ni_660x_auto_attach() 1212 mite_detach(devpriv->mite); in ni_660x_detach()
|
| H A D | ni_mio_common.c | 463 if (!devpriv->mite && reg < 8) { in ni_stc_writew() 496 if (!devpriv->mite && reg < 8) { in ni_stc_readw() 584 mite_chan = mite_request_channel(devpriv->mite, devpriv->ai_mite_ring); in ni_request_ai_mite_channel() 639 mite_chan = mite_request_channel(devpriv->mite, in ni_request_gpct_mite_channel() 2851 if (devpriv->mite) in ni_ao_insn_config() 2852 data[2] += devpriv->mite->fifo_size; in ni_ao_insn_config() 5924 if (devpriv->mite) { in ni_E_interrupt() 6066 if (devpriv->mite) in ni_E_init() 6097 if (dev->irq && (board->ao_fifo_depth || devpriv->mite)) { in ni_E_init() 6107 if (devpriv->mite) in ni_E_init() [all …]
|
| H A D | Makefile | 137 obj-$(CONFIG_COMEDI_MITE) += mite.o
|
| H A D | ni_stc.h | 1037 struct mite *mite; member
|
| /linux-6.15/Documentation/translations/sp_SP/scheduler/ |
| H A D | sched-bwc.rst | 48 Esto garantiza dos cosas: que cada tiempo límite de ejecución es cumplido 52 límite de ejecución de la tarea, pero en el siguiente periodo de ejecución 53 el tiempo límite de la tarea estaría todavía más lejos, y nunca se tendría 64 tareas en el sistema), pero al coste de perder el instante límite de 76 en medio, hay un umbral donde una tarea excede su tiempo límite de 81 tiempo límite de ejecución será \Sum e_i; esto es una retraso acotado 85 de fallar en el cumplimiento del tiempo límite y el promedio de WCET. 117 definirá el límite del ancho de banda. La cuota mínima permitida para 123 Asignar cualquier valor negativo a cpu.cfs_quota_us eliminará el límite de 130 el límite con el ancho de banda acumulado no usado. [all …]
|
| H A D | sched-eevdf.rst | 28 calcula un tiempo límite de ejecución virtual (VD, del inglés: virtual
|
| /linux-6.15/Documentation/translations/sp_SP/process/ |
| H A D | maintainer-kvm-x86.rst | 226 con una enmienda: no trate el límite de 70-75 caracteres como un límite 227 absoluto y duro. En su lugar, utilice 75 caracteres como límite firme, pero 228 no duro, y 80 caracteres como límite duro. Es decir, deje que el registro 229 corto sobrepase en algunos caracteres el límite estándar si tiene una buena
|
| H A D | 6.Followthrough.rst | 216 esto tiene un límite. Si se interpreta que bloque buen trabajo, esos
|
| H A D | deprecated.rst | 173 sobrepasar el límite de tamaño del destino. Esto ineficiente y puede causar
|
| H A D | 4.Coding.rst | 67 para ajustarse al límite de 80 columnas, por ejemplo), perfecto.
|
| H A D | coding-style.rst | 111 El límite preferido en la longitud de una sola línea es de 80 columnas.
|